The Ethics of Autonomous Machines: Navigating Uncharted Territory
As we delve deeper into the realm of artificial intelligence, autonomous machines are rapidly becoming a tangible reality. These systems, capable of making decisions and carrying out tasks without human intervention, offer immense potential in various sectors. However, their growing autonomy raises profound ethical dilemmas that demand careful consideration. Securing responsible development and deployment of autonomous machines is paramount to addressing potential risks and maximizing societal advantages.
- Explainability in algorithmic decision-making is crucial for building trust and analyzing the rationale behind autonomous actions.
- Discrimination in training data can lead to unfair or discriminatory outcomes, emphasizing the need for diverse datasets.
- The distribution of responsibility and liability in cases of harm caused by autonomous machines remains a complex issue.
Navigating this uncharted territory requires collaborative efforts involving experts in artificial intelligence, policymakers, industry leaders, and the general public. By fostering open conversation and establishing robust ethical frameworks, we can strive to harness the power of autonomous machines for the benefit of humanity while minimizing potential harm.

From Siri to Sentience: The Evolution of Conversational AI
The journey of conversational AI has been one of remarkable advancement, from its humble beginnings as rule-based systems to the sophisticated platforms we see today. Early attempts, like ELIZA in the 1960s, could replicate human conversation to a limited extent, primarily by identifying keywords and providing canned responses. However, the real breakthrough came with the advent of machine learning algorithms.
These algorithms, particularly deep learning networks, enabled AI systems to process vast amounts of information, learning patterns and connections within language. This led to a boom in the development of more natural and engaging conversational agents.
Today, we have interactive bots like Siri, Alexa, and Google Assistant that can not only interpret our requests but also generate human-like responses, providing information.
